WebWe move the catheter up through your blood vessels until it gets to your aortic aneurysm. Then, we send the stent-graft through the catheter to the aneurysm. We place it where the aneurysm is found. It opens and supports your aorta. Blood flows through the stent-graft. That keeps it from pushing against the aneurysm.

Your sternum, or breastbone, is a flat, narrow bone that runs vertically (up and down) between your left and right rib cages.

WebAorta surgery also treats aortic dissection, or the separation of your aorta wall’s layers. Blood flows through a tear in the inner layer of your aorta. This is a life-threatening condition. People born with rare heart conditions like coarctation (narrowing) of the aorta or transposition (reversal) of the great arteries also need aorta surgery. WebFeb 15, 2024 · Off-pump heart surgery is open-heart surgery on a beating heart without using a heart-lung bypass machine. The surgeon holds the heart steady with a device. Surgeons may use off-pump heart surgery to do coronary artery bypass grafts (CABG), but only in certain cases. Minimally invasive heart surgery uses small cuts between the ribs. …

Often, this is done for more than one coronary artery during the same surgery. … dhhs dd servicesWebMar 24, 2024 · One possible complication is that the graft will become blocked with plaque and limit or stop blood flow to the heart. If your graft stops working, this may cause a heart attack or other problem with your heart, and you may need additional surgery or PCI. Know the signs of a heart attack and call 9-1-1 right away.
